    Job Summary:

    The SIL Outreach Support Worker meets individuals either at their home or in the community and provides emotional and practical support to foster independence. The support to the person is individualized and is required to address challenges, access resources, develop life and social skills and help build a support network for the individual. Community access with the individual is required.

    This position does require a high degree of collaboration with the SIL Outreach Workers who will maintain administrative oversight to the individuals in the SIL program. Some administrative duties like completing contact notes, mileage claims and filling out incident reports as needed is also required.

    • Provide support hours as determined by the person's PDD budget
    • Monitor and report progress of the individuals
    • Complete case notes after every visit or after every contact with the individual(s)
    • Complete monthly mileage and expense claims
    • Establish and maintain connections with community resources
    • Maintain and model appropriate personal boundaries
    • Provide consistent teaching and support around specific life and social skills
    • Support individual(s) with problem-solving, communication and conflict resolution through role modelling and coaching
    • Build social and other support networks to assist individuals to be as independent aspossible
    • Assist individuals with different aspects of daily living, including but not limited to arranging and attending medical appointments, grocery shopping, budgeting, teaching cooking skills or other domestic/life skills
    • Research and provide community resources to individuals to assist them as needed
    • If appropriate meet the individual out in the community for social activities
    • Facilitate practical changes and/or initiate activities to enhance in the individuals' physical and social environments to promote their well-being and self-esteem
    • Understand and manage behaviors the individual may be experiencing
    • Recognize, monitor, and respond to medical concerns
    • Provide crisis intervention to emergency situations during face-to-face meetings. This may include First Aid/CPR, protection against injury to the person or others, medical intervention (calling an ambulance or taking the individual to seek medical care), etc.
    • Respect and protect all sensitive and confidential information
    • Attend regular team meetings, case consultations and service reviews as required
    • Report incidents to the supervisor
    • Maintain current knowledge and practice of Agency policies and procedures
    • Perform other duties as assigned
